次の方法で共有


DCompositionAttachMouseDragToHwnd 関数 (dcomp.h)

マウス ボタンを下に移動し、後続の移動イベントと上のイベントを特定の HWND にルーティングする Interaction/InputSink を作成します。 移動のしきい値はありません。有効にすると、ダウンを含むイベントとダウン後のすべてのイベントが、指定されたウィンドウに無条件にリダイレクトされます。 この API を呼び出した後、ビジュアルを所有するデバイスをコミットする必要があります。

構文

HRESULT DCompositionAttachMouseDragToHwnd(
  [in] IDCompositionVisual *visual,
  [in] HWND                hwnd,
  [in] BOOL                enable
);

パラメーター

[in] visual

型: IDCompositionVisual*

メッセージのルーティング元のビジュアル。

[in] hwnd

型: HWND

メッセージをルーティングする HWND。

[in] enable

種類: BOOL

ルーティングを有効または無効にするかどうかを示すブール値。

戻り値

型: HRESULT

この関数が成功すると、 S_OKが返されます。 そうでない場合は、HRESULT エラー コードを返します。

要件

   
対象プラットフォーム Windows
ヘッダー dcomp.h
Library Dcomp.lib
[DLL] Dcomp.dll